Output 99098df675632196139263e90bcb5e7190c680d77ef047e00e39a7c0f13991f2:5

value
5231899
script pubkey
OP_0 OP_PUSHBYTES_20 d65b690e8609be6f60289e1cf7a7e5c5c31bfc2b
address
bc1q6edkjr5xpxlx7cpgncw00fl9chp3hlptlgvgkv
transaction
99098df675632196139263e90bcb5e7190c680d77ef047e00e39a7c0f13991f2
confirmations
110935
spent
true